Any electronic sight? I've never had a dead battery in my Aimpoint H1 and it is always on. About every 3+ years when I routinely check the reticle it seems a bit dim, so I change the (not dead) battery. I'm on the 3rd one, it's been on since I bought it in '08.

I sent 2 back. Yes I liked them very much. However if purchased at big bucks based on hell or high water reliability, they had deceived us. Secondly, besides the temperature related POI shift, there was discussion of how corrosion was an eventual issue, even in as little as 90 days in harsh environments. I can spend much less on dots that eventually go bad. I think the big bucks are for proven winners in reliability.
